4227a37a805871ed197cbaf80008086ea4c75871
[supertux.git] / Jamfile
1 SubDir TOP ;
2
3 if $(XGETTEXT) != ""
4 {
5     actions XGetText
6     {
7         $(XGETTEXT) $(XGETTEXT_FLAGS) --keyword='_:1' -o $(<) $(>)
8     }
9     rule MakePot
10     {
11       if $(>) {
12         XGetText $(<) : $(>) ;
13         Depends $(<) : $(>) ;
14         Depends all : $(<) ;
15       }
16     }
17 } else {
18     rule MakePot
19     { }
20 }
21
22 # Decend into subdirs
23 SubInclude TOP lib ;
24 SubInclude TOP src ;
25 SubInclude TOP data ;
26
27 UseAutoconf ;
28
29 # add some additional files to package
30 Package INSTALL NEWS README COPYING AUTHORS ChangeLog ;
31
32 MakePot data/locale/messages.pot : $(TRANSLATABLE_SOURCES) ;
33 XGETTEXT_FLAGS on data/locale/messages.pot += --language=C++ ;